Extended Data Fig. 9: Association of the P681R mutation with sensitivity to NAbs.
From: Enhanced fusogenicity and pathogenicity of SARS-CoV-2 Delta P681R mutation

a, Neutralization assay using three monoclonal antibodies (clones 8A5, 4A3 and CB6). Assays were performed in triplicate. b,c, Neutralization assay using 19 vaccinated sera. Pseudoviruses and effector cells (S-expressing cells) were treated with serially diluted NAbs or sera as described in Methods. Assays were performed in triplicate. The raw data of panel b are shown in panel c. NT50, 50% neutralization titre. In b, each dot indicates the mean NT50 value of the respective donor. A statistically significant difference versus the D614G virus was determined by two-sided Wilcoxon matched-pairs signed rank test. In c, the NT50 values of D614G S (black) and D614G/P681R S (orange) for each serum are indicated in each panel.
